As soon as European settlement began to expand inland, it conflicted directly with Aboriginal land tenure and financial routines and entailed the desecration of Aboriginal sacred websites and home. Clashes marked nearly all conditions the place conflicting pursuits ended up pursued, along with the Europeans seen Aboriginal peoples as parasites upon nature, defining their cultures in wholly negative terms.
Fish were being occasionally taken by hand by stirring up the muddy base of the pool until eventually they rose into the surface, or by placing the crushed leaves of poisonous vegetation from the water to stupefy them. Fish spears, nets, wicker or stone traps had been also utilised in various spots. Lines with hooks created from bone, shell, wood or spines had been utilised alongside the north and east coasts. Dugong, turtle and huge fish ended up harpooned, the harpooner launching himself bodily with the canoe to present added fat on the thrust.
Aboriginal peoples who lived about the north coast ended up the only kinds to encounter international guests right before European settlement. Seagoing Makassarese traders from your Indonesian archipelago began generating typical visits to Arnhem Land someday prior to the 1700s to reap bêche-de-mer (sea cucumber, or trepang) for export to China. They'd a robust effect on neighborhood artwork, songs, ritual, and product tradition.
